WebThey generally range from 6000V to 15000V, with about 30mA. There are 2 kinds of Neon Sign Transformers, one is iron cored and runs at 50Hz, while the other is the new smaller switchmode one which run at 20kHz and is a lot lighter. The heavy iron-cored ones usually perform better. The ultimate transformer would be a Pole Pig. Note: Before testing any components in a microwave, be sure the unit is unplugged and the high voltage … WebThe voltage in your home is typically 120V. The output voltage on your microwave is around 2100-3000 V. Capacitors are rated in Farads. Farads measure how much charge the capacitor can hold. A larger number is a higher rating and holds more charge. A microwave capacitor may have around 0.95-1.00 microFarad capacitance.
